I bought a fuel pump for my 78 150 off of ebay, the seller stated it would fit my motor. The pump that I recceived has the same exact body as my old pump but the threaded O-ring male barb discharge fitting is for a small 1/8" hose so I ended up not using it becase all my fuel lines are 5/16". I have since then bought the correct pump with the 5/16" fitting. The only difference I can see in the two pumps is the size of the fitting, Ive been two several different hydraulic shops and parts stores and cant seem to find one. Im guessing that this is a special OMC part. Does anyone know where I can buy just the barbed fitting so I can actually use this pump?

You may have a VRO/OMS pump for a 40HP to 50HP motor (# 435559 or superseding part# 5007421) these had the smaller fitting.

Edit: If you are referring to a conventional lift pump, the fitting is part number 0350971 and the larger one is 0343576, the o-ring is part # 0305739. You can find them at ishopmarine.com if your local guy is too busy.
